In the recent assembly elections in Keralam, voter turnout surged to 77.45%, a notable increase from 74.06% in the previous elections. With over 2.71 crore eligible voters and 883 candidates, the turnout trends indicate a shift in voter behavior. The early morning hours, from 7 am to 11 am, saw a significant turnout, primarily driven by committed party supporters from organizations like the Communist Party of India (Marxist) and the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h-Bharatiya Janata Party (RSS-BJP). This surge may signal a 'silent wave' of anti-incumbency as voters express dissent. In contrast, the midday period often reflects urban apathy, while rural areas maintain higher engagement. The evening voting hours, from 4 pm to 6 pm, attract undecided voters, which could favor opposition parties. Overall, the timing of voter turnout provides critical insights into the political dynamics in Keralam.
